Der volle Inhalt der QuelleThe rise of connected devices and the data they produce has driven the development of large-scale applications. These devices form distributed networks with decentralized data processing. As the number of devices grows, challenges like communication overhead and computational costs increase, requiring optimization methods that work under strict resource constraints, especially where derivatives are unavailable or costly. This thesis focuses on zero-order (ZO) optimization methods are ideal for scenarios where explicit function derivatives are inaccessible. ZO methods estimate gradients based only on function evaluations, making them highly suitable for distributed and federated learning environments where devices collaborate to solve global optimization tasks with limited information and noisy data. In the first chapter, we address distributed ZO optimization for strongly convex functions across multiple agents in a network. We propose a distributed zero-order projected gradient descent algorithm that uses one-point gradient estimates, where the function is queried only once per stochastic realization, and noisy function evaluations estimate the gradient. The chapter establishes the almost sure convergence of the algorithm and derives theoretical upper bounds on the convergence rate. With constant step sizes, the algorithm achieves a linear convergence rate. This is the first time this rate has been established for one-point (and even two-point) gradient estimates. We also analyze the effects of diminishing step sizes, establishing a convergence rate that matches centralized ZO methods' lower bounds. The second chapter addresses the challenges of federated learning (FL) which is often hindered by the communication bottleneck—the high cost of transmitting large amounts of data over limited-bandwidth networks. To address this, we propose a novel zero-order federated learning (ZOFL) algorithm that reduces communication overhead using one-point gradient estimates. Devices transmit scalar values instead of large gradient vectors, lowering the data sent over the network. Moreover, the algorithm incorporates wireless communication disturbances directly into the optimization process, eliminating the need for explicit knowledge of the channel state. This approach is the first to integrate wireless channel properties into a learning algorithm, making it resilient to real-world communication issues. We prove the almost sure convergence of this method in nonconvex optimization settings, establish its convergence rate, and validate its effectiveness through experiments. In the final chapter, we extend the ZOFL algorithm to include two-point gradient estimates. Unlike one-point estimates, which rely on a single function evaluation, two-point estimates query the function twice, providing a more accurate gradient approximation and enhancing the convergence rate. This method maintains the communication efficiency of one-point estimates, where only scalar values are transmitted, and relaxes the assumption that the objective function must be bounded. The chapter demonstrates that the proposed two-point ZO method achieves linear convergence rates for strongly convex and smooth objective functions. For nonconvex problems, the method shows improved convergence speed, particularly when the objective function is smooth and K-gradient-dominated, where a linear rate is also achieved. We also analyze the impact of constant versus diminishing step sizes and provide numerical results showing the method's communication efficiency compared to other federated learning techniques

Der volle Inhalt der QuelleDans une première partie nous étudions plusieurs variantes du modèle PKS classique, incluant notamment une diffusion non-linéaire des cellules, ou bien une loi de diffusion chimique à noyau de Green logarithmique. Puis nous montrons l'existence globale pour une masse sous-critique du modèle PKS classique dans tout l'espace $\mathbb{R}^2$.
On complexifie ensuite le modèle de base en ajoutant un intermédiaire chimique réactionnel, ce qui modifie l'homogénéité du système. Enfin les conditions d'existence globale pour le modèle cinétique ODA avec effets délocalisants sont affaiblies par rapport aux travaux précédents.
Dans une deuxième partie nous appliquons le modèle phénoménologique de PKS, et son principe de masse critique, à un processus d'auto-organisation remarquable dans le cerveau: la sclérose concentrique de Baló. Un couplage adéquat entre un front de propagation et une instabilité de PKS décrit raisonnablement les motifs en anneaux de la maladie.
La troisième partie adopte le point de vue du transport optimal de masse pour analyser le modèle de PKS unidimensionnel modifié auparavant (afin de partager les caractéristiques de PKS 2D). Bien que la fonctionnelle d'énergie ne soit pas convexe par déplacement, nous démontrons la convergence vers un unique état d'équilibre, lorsqu'il existe. Ces nouvelles idées sont mises en oeuvre numériquement~: un flot gradient discret pour la distance de Wasserstein est analysé, puis simulé en dimension un d'espace.
Plusieurs annexes viennent compléter ce travail, dont une annexe qui regroupe tous les aspects numériques de la thèse.

Der volle Inhalt der QuelleThis work deals with the damage detection of composite materials. These materials are used in the aeronautics industry. The first part concerns the development of methods to estimate the heat sources terms of a stressed material. During this process, a set of mechanical defects leads to heat productions. The sources detection can conduct to the detection of these defects. Two main methods are presented: a "direct" method based on a discretization of the measured temperature field and an "iterative" method based on the conjugate gradient method. These methods are coupled with data filtering techniques such as SVD. In order to optimize computation time, equations are solved by finite differences in their linear form. Modifications are also made for the iterative algorithm to improve its convergence as well as the results of the estimation. These problems are considered as thermal inverse problems. The main objective of the first part is to find an experimental link between the appearance of a macro fissure and the localization of a heat source term within a composite material. The second part consists in the elaboration of methods for estimating thermal directional diffusivities. The methods are based on a modeling of heat transfer using thermal quadrupoles. Parameter estimations are made on targeted "risked" areas on a material, which is already damaged but not under stress. The aim is to link a known mechanical damage, which is called "diffuse" to thermal properties degradation in the main directions. This manuscript is presented in two parts: a validation part of the methods, and an experimental part in which composites are analyzed
